Summary:
We are seeking a highly motivated Staff IC Packaging Engineer to lead the development and commercialization of advanced integrated circuit (IC) packaging technologies. This role focuses on driving innovation and enabling new product introductions. The ideal candidate will possess deep expertise in advanced packaging architectures and assembly processes, and will lead technology development from concept through high-volume manufacturing (HVM) in collaboration with Outsourced Semiconductor Assembly and Test (OSAT) partners.
This position requires strong technical leadership, cross-functional collaboration, and the ability to solve complex engineering challenges.
Duties and Responsibilities
* Lead development and deployment of advanced packaging technologies including FCCSP, FCBGA, SiP/Modules, RDL-based packages, and 2.5D/3D integration.
* Drive new product introduction (NPI) from concept to successful transfer into high-volume manufacturing.
* Define and optimize package architectures, including high-density interconnects, die-to-die (D2D) integration, and performance/reliability trade-offs.
* Develop and establish process flows, material sets, Best Known Methods (BKM), and process control plans.
* Design and execute Design of Experiments (DOE), test vehicles, and process characterization for technology development and qualification.
* Collaborate with OSATs, foundries, substrate vendors, and material suppliers to align technology development with product requirements.
* Partner with internal design, modeling, and product teams to implement Design for Manufacturability (DFM) and establish design rules.
* Lead cross-functional programs, managing timelines, risks, and deliverables across multiple concurrent projects.
* Apply strong knowledge of FMEA, SPC/QC, reliability testing, and failure analysis to ensure robust product development.
* Troubleshoot and resolve complex technical and manufacturing issues across development and production stages.
